Finished chapter on the second economy. I think the most interesting part is how it disrupts the necessary feedback loop within a centrally planned economy and leads to both the theft of state resources by those in the second economy as well as the misallocation of resources as since the second economy would fill shortage gaps, planners could not account for these gaps in the future.
